roli_bark:
Ooops sorry, elaborate:

The goal is to get a Logic representation of all Analog Channels.
Today there's only one Math function in Rigol Scopes (displayed as 'Deep Blue). To get the Math function represent CH.1 as logic '0'/'1', a Math = 'A or B' can be defined for example, where A is sourced by Ch.1 & B by Ch.2 (tied to Ground). Now the 'Deep-Blue' Math display represents Ch.1 digitally.

My question is whether it is possible to defined 2 Math functions for the 2 channels (or 4 for 4)

Example:
Math set to the logic option. And the logic equations are defined as,
Math-1 = A or GND
Math-2 = B or GND
Math-3 = C or GND
Math-4 = D or GND

Where A is sourced by Analog Ch.1 (with the appropriate Threshold defined for Ch.1)
Where B is sourced by Analog Ch.2 (with the appropriate Threshold defined for Ch.2)
Where C is sourced by Analog Ch.3 (with the appropriate Threshold defined for Ch.3)
Where D is sourced by Analog Ch.4 (with the appropriate Threshold defined for Ch.4)

with the option to display only Math-1, Math-2, Math3, Math4 (and not as an overlay).

marmad:

--- Quote from: roli_bark on May 15, 2013, 05:07:59 am ---My question is whether it is possible to defined 2 Math functions for the 2 channels (or 4 for 4)
--- End quote ---

No. The DS2000 can display only one Math waveform at a time.


--- Quote ---with the option to display only Math-1, Math-2, Math3, Math4 (and not as an overlay).
--- End quote ---

No. If channel 1 or 2 are turned on (visible), they can be used as a source - if they're not visible, they can't be a source.
